Back | Home

Daylesford Farmshop & Café

Set over three floors, our stunning organic farmshop & café on Sloane Avenue celebrates the sensational food and artisan produce from our ORGANIC FARM IN THE COTSWOLDS.

Is this your company?

Is this your company?

Why not check out other Local food in London

Enquire Directly

Go to Website

Contact Details

Daylesford Farmshop & Café
76-82 Sloane Avenue
Brompton Cross
London
SW3 3DZ

Rating/Reviews

Be the first to Rate/ReviewDaylesford Farmshop & Café »